HBO Max renewed the hit ballroom competition series Legendary for a third season.

Dashaun Wesley will return as MC Leiomy Maldonado, Jameela Jamil, Law Roach and Megan Thee Stallion will return as judges.

“We’ve only begun to scratch the surface when it comes to showcasing the beautiful world that is ballroom,” said Jennifer O’Connell, Executive Vice President, Non-Fiction and Live-Action Family Programming, HBO Max. “We are excited to work with our partners at Scout again to take this show to even greater heights in season three and continuing to shine a light on these compelling stories.”

“We are thrilled to return with our friends at HBO MAX, as well as our iconic judges and MC Dashaun Wesley, for a third season,” said Rob Eric, Scout Productions’ Chief Creative Officer and Executive Producer. “We can’t wait for the next season’s talent to set the bar even higher as we continue to showcase the fabulous world of ballroom.”

Season 2 saw the crowning of the House of Miyake-Mugler. The House of Balenciaga was the runner-up. The season also featured the controversial elimination of the fan-favorite house, the House of Tisci.

Legendary is produced by Scout Productions.
